TL;DR

OpenAI has hired the most recent Fields Medalist, signaling a focus on advanced reasoning capabilities. Meanwhile, ByteDance’s AI lab launched a program targeting top young researchers, intensifying the US-China talent competition.

OpenAI has reportedly hired the most recent winner of the Fields Medal, the highest honor in mathematics, according to a report by Chinese outlet 36Kr. The move underscores the company’s focus on enhancing mathematical reasoning in its AI models, a key area for advancing beyond pattern matching, as detailed in the original analysis. The individual’s exact identity remains unconfirmed, and OpenAI has not publicly announced the hire.

The report indicates that the mathematician joining OpenAI is the latest recipient of the Fields Medal, awarded every four years to mathematicians under 40, as discussed in this internal link. This move aligns with OpenAI’s recent emphasis on reasoning-centric AI research, aiming to improve model reliability and interpretability. The report did not specify the terms of the hire, including start date or compensation, and OpenAI has not issued a formal statement.

Simultaneously, ByteDance’s AI research arm, Seed, launched a new scientist program aimed at recruiting outstanding young AI researchers. The program is designed to cultivate a pipeline of talent early, focusing on long-term research within ByteDance’s foundation models, including the Doubao family. Details about program size, funding, and specific research areas remain undisclosed.

US-China Competition for AI Talent Intensifies

Over the past few years, leading AI labs in the United States and China have been engaged in a fierce competition for top researchers, often involving high-profile hires and specialized programs. The recruitment of a Fields Medalist, a rare move from academia to industry, exemplifies how deep mathematical expertise is increasingly viewed as essential for next-generation AI development. ByteDance’s investment in young talent through Seed aligns with this trend, aiming to develop a future pipeline of researchers before they are hired by Western firms.

Historically, most Fields Medalists remain in academia, making such industry moves notable and indicative of a strategic shift toward recruiting researchers with exceptional mathematical skills for advanced AI research.

Key Questions

What is the significance of the Fields Medal in mathematics?

The Fields Medal is the most prestigious award in mathematics, awarded every four years to two to four mathematicians under 40, often called the ‘Nobel Prize of Mathematics.’ Its recipients typically work in academia, and a move to industry is considered highly notable.
